Abstract: Method for producing silicon which is suitable as a starting material for producing a silicon melt for the fabrication of silicon blocks or silicon crystals, comprising the following steps: introducing a gaseous mixture of monosilane and hydrogen into a reactor, thermal degrading the gaseous mixture for forming silicon powder, separating the formed silicon powder produced from the gaseous mixture, and mechanical compacting the separated silicon powder with compacting rollers which having a roller jacket consisting of a ceramic material selected from graphite, glass and silicon nitride.

Abstract: In a reactor for the decomposition of a silicon-containing gas, provision is made, to avoid silicon deposition on an inner wall of a reactor vessel, for at least one catalytically active mesh to be provided within a reaction chamber between at least one gas feed line and the inner wall (4). The mesh accelerates the thermal decomposition of the gas and reduces the deposition of silicon on the inner wall. Also described is a process for the preparation of silicon using the reactor according to the invention and the use in photovoltaics of the silicon prepared.
Abstract: Compacting device for the low-metal compaction of a powder with a casing which at least in part surrounds a working chamber, with a feed arrangement arranged on the casing and feeding a powder, which is to be compacted, into the working chamber, with at least a compacting roller which is rotatably arranged in the working chamber, comprises a roller jacket and, together with an opposing wall, forms a compacting gap for compacting the powder therein, characterised in that the at least one compacting roller consists of ceramic, at least on the roller jacket.

Abstract: Method for manufacturing a reactor for separating a gas containing silicon, comprising the following stages: preparation of a substantially tubular reactor blank with an inner wall and an outer wall, and application of a separating layer containing a powdery separating medium, at least onto the inner wall of the reactor blank. The reactor with the separating layer applied thereon offers simple and effective protection of the inner wall from deposited silicon powder. The separating layer and the silicon powder deposited thereon can easily be removed mechanically, without the inner wall being damaged.
